Job description

The Energy Systems Support Engineering Lead provides support for industrial battery energy storage products. This primarily involves leading and working with a team of engineers to diagnose and resolve equipment problems reported by Tesla’s customers and internal automated monitoring infrastructure. This is accomplished in connection with Tesla’s asset managers and internal technicians, 3rd party on-site field technicians, and external site owners.

This role is on-site, and can sit out of any of the following locations: Fremont, Palo Alto, Lathrop, CA, or Austin, TX What You’ll Do

  • Become the technical owner for a portfolio of commercial or utility sites and ensure the defined tasks are completed timely and appropriately
  • Lead the team to detect and diagnose product and site issues, support technical questions from other teams and customers, and drive issues to resolution
  • Organize retrospective meetings as needed and seek feedback from leadership and internal stakeholders to drive process and efficiency improvement over time
  • Lead the team to manage sites outages and ensure outages are logged and classified properly by identifying the issues, causes and the responsible party of each outage
  • Perform site audits and communicate audit results and concerns to cross-functional teams including Asset Management, Service Engineering, Field Services, and SCADA team, etc.
  • Support planned customer testing as required in LTSA including energy capacity testing, RTE, and Frequency and respond to the emergency and urgent requests as needed for high-impact sites
  • Maintain and optimize the health and performance of the utility sites through firmware and software updates, Own tracking high-impact technical issues and leading the cross-functional team to implement solutions
